"Since the (model) code came into force, unaccounted cash worth Rs 5.39 crore and 2 kg silver were seized in the district during raids conducted by various squads," district collector cum election officer Neetu Prasad said in a statement last night.
In the district, election for three Lok Sabha and 19 Assembly seats will be held on May 7 along with 25 Lok Sabha and 175 Assembly seats in Seemandhra region.
On poll preparedness, the officer said engineers will be deployed at all polling stations in the district to fix EVMs should they malfunction.
